United Goans Foundation asks Election Commissioner to stall delimitation process

MARGAO: United Goans Foundation (UGF) on Tuesday requested the Election Commissioner to stay the process and postpone the deadline of submission of inputs by public till such a time that the map of delimitation along with all details is made available to the them, stating that it is impossible for a common citizen to be involved in the process of providing inputs towards delimitation merely based on house numbers.

Dr Ashish Kamat, President UGF,”We have requested to inspect the plan of delimited boundaries so as to understand the inclusion of new areas as mapped and as required by the statute for better understanding of ground reality. We had also asked the Mamlatdar if the same is uploaded on the website along with the map,” he said. 

Dr Ashish further said that they were informed by the Mamlatdar that the Map is not included for public inspection.

“Hence we would like to object to the incomplete and incorrect process adopted by the Goa SEC wherein the map hasn’t been provided to the citizens and further that the Government is trying to rush through the process without following proper protocol and procedure,” he added. 

UGF has brought to the notice of EC that the right of every constituent to be taken into consideration and that proper public consultation be undertaken through a gram sabha, where every aspect is delved upon to the understating of the constituents so then he can put forth his views and objections to the Government which in this case is not followed and the public are kept in the dark.
